Flood damage cleanup services involve the removal of excess water and the restoration of affected properties following flooding events. These services typically include water extraction, drying, dehumidification, and cleaning of affected surfaces and materials. The goal is to mitigate further damage, prevent mold growth, and restore the property to its pre-flood condition. Professionals use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ure thorough removal of moisture and contaminants, helping to reduce long-term issues caused by water intrusion.
Flood damage can lead to a range of problems if not addressed promptly, including structural damage, mold development, and compromised indoor air quality. Water can weaken building foundations, warp wood, and cause paint or drywall to deteriorate. Additionally, standing water and damp environments can foster mold growth, which may pose health risks to occupants. Flood cleanup services are designed to address these issues efficiently, minimizing the potential for ongoing damage and health concerns.

Initial Cleanup Costs - The cost for flood damage cleanup typically ranges from $3,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of water intrusion and affected areas. Smaller residential projects may be on the lower end, while larger homes or commercial spaces can be more expensive.
Water Extraction Expenses - Professional water removal services generally cost between $1,000 and $4,000. Factors influencing the price include the volume of water to be extracted and the type of equipment used.
Mold Remediation Costs - If mold is present after flooding, remediation services often range from $500 to $6,000. The size of the affected area and mold severity significantly impact the overall cost.
Structural Drying Fees - Structural drying services usually fall within a $2,000 to $8,000 range. This process involves specialized equipment to thoroughly dry out building materials and prevent further damage.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
